#7D905C Hex Color Code

#7D905C

The Hexadecimal Color #7D905C is a contrast shade of Gray. #7D905C RGB value is rgb(125, 144, 92). RGB Color Model of #7D905C consists of 49% red, 56% green and 36% blue. HSL color Mode of #7D905C has 82°(degrees) Hue, 22% Saturation and 46% Lightness. #7D905C color has an wavelength of 568.37037n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#7D905C is #999966.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#7D905C is #785. The Closest Color to #7D905C is #808080. Official Name of #7D905C Hex Code is Glade Green.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#7D905C is 13 Cyan 0 Magenta 36 Yellow 44 Black and #7D905C CMY is 13, 0, 36.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#7D905C is hsl(82,22,46,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(82, 36, 56).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#7D905C is 20.36, 25.08, 13.89.
Hex8 Value of #7D905C is #7D905CFF. Decimal Value of #7D905C is 8228956 and Octal Value of #7D905C is 37310134. Binary Value of #7D905C is 1111101, 10010000, 1011100 and Android of #7D905C is 4286419036 / 0xff7d905c.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#7D905C is 0.343, 0.423, 0.423 and YIQ Color Space of #7D905C is 132.391, 5.3855, -20.2009.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#7D905C is 23.44, 28.33, 14.06.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#7D905C is 57.15, -16.15, 25.45.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#7D905C is 57.15, -8.92, 34.71.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#7D905C is 57.15, 30.14, 122.4. Hunter Lab variable of #7D905C is 50.08, -15.07, 18.61.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#7D905C

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
